YouTube monetization requirements and guidelines

Before you can monetize your NFL videos on YouTube, it’s crucial to meet certain requirements and adhere to YouTube’s guidelines. These requirements include:

  • 1,000 subscribers: You need to have at least 1,000 subscribers on your YouTube channel.
  • 4,000 watch hours: Your videos must accumulate a total of 4,000 watch hours within the past 12 months.
  • Compliance with YouTube’s policies: Your content must adhere to YouTube’s community guidelines, copyright policies, and advertiser-friendly content guidelines.

Meeting these requirements demonstrates your commitment to creating valuable content and ensures that your channel is eligible for monetization.

Common mistakes to avoid when monetizing YouTube videos

To ensure a smooth monetization journey, it’s important to avoid common mistakes that can hinder your progress:

Violating YouTube’s policies and guidelines

Make sure to familiarize yourself with YouTube’s policies and guidelines and ensure that your NFL videos comply with them. Violating these policies can lead to demonetization or even the termination of your YouTube channel.

Clickbait and misleading content

Avoid using clickbait or misleading titles, thumbnails, or descriptions to attract viewers. While clickbait may generate short-term views, it damages your credibility and can lead to a negative user experience.

Neglecting SEO optimization

Optimize your NFL videos for search engines to increase their visibility and reach. Neglecting SEO can result in your videos being buried in search results, making it difficult for potential viewers to discover your content.

Ignoring audience feedback and engagement

Engage with your audience by responding to comments, asking for feedback, and incorporating their suggestions into your future videos. Ignoring audience feedback can lead to a lack of engagement and hinder the growth of your channel.
